Transaction 57769819691d044fdc73a7a4e4873f4224c84c4f7ec9eb77bdd77002a16bf2d5

1 Input
2 Outputs
  • 57769819691d044fdc73a7a4e4873f4224c84c4f7ec9eb77bdd77002a16bf2d5:0
  • value  2142517
    address  3MuH3gnWmunusBLDbxk7aTqrUZcs5sTbDv
  • 57769819691d044fdc73a7a4e4873f4224c84c4f7ec9eb77bdd77002a16bf2d5:1
  • value  1063215
    address  3DYBE3fWV4wXH39AxJ4k6AicpFrBzne1gN